Transaction e171037c593800020eb03c1b2b4011152b625743f9ab7c2c6c4ec19d85f4e3a9
1 Input
2 Outputs
- e171037c593800020eb03c1b2b4011152b625743f9ab7c2c6c4ec19d85f4e3a9:0
- e171037c593800020eb03c1b2b4011152b625743f9ab7c2c6c4ec19d85f4e3a9:1
value 100000
address 17WJ4gZAPKJhVzYJrw3kEVZjWe4gUrxSMU
value 255295049
address 356fU64uSTydGcu87cBEnLtSDseVA785KV